Skip to content
Snippets Groups Projects

Allow generating particles over an annulus between two radii

Merged Carl Gwilliam requested to merge gwilliam/calypso:radial_sampler_update into master
3 files
+ 16
7
Compare changes
  • Side-by-side
  • Inline
Files
3
@@ -40,7 +40,7 @@ def faser_pgparser():
help="Specify PDG ID of particle (note plus/minus different) or list (e.g.: --pid -13 13)")
parser.add_argument("--mass", default=105.66, type=float,
help="Specify particle mass (in MeV)")
parser.add_argument("--radius", default=100., type=float,
parser.add_argument("--radius", default=100., type=float, nargs="*",
help="Specify radius (in mm)")
parser.add_argument("--angle", default=0.005, type=float_or_none,
help="Specify angular width (in Rad)")
@@ -55,7 +55,7 @@ def faser_pgparser():
parser.add_argument("--sampler", default="log",
help="Specify energy sampling (log, lin, const, hist, hist2D)")
parser.add_argument("--hist_name", default="log",
parser.add_argument("--hist_name", default="",
help="Specify energy sampling name for hist sampler file.root:hist")
parser.add_argument("--minE", default=10., type=float,
Loading